You know what I like with good, spicy Pinot Noir? Those herb crusted soft ripened cheeses (especially double and triple cremes) you often see in grocery stores. The aromatic green herbs really meld with the flavor of Pinot. One particular standout for me has been a garlic-herb Boursin -- yummy with Pinot. I'm getting hungry... and thirst.
